Related occupations
Explore related occupations in the lead educator sector.
Childcare Assistant
A Childcare Assistant cares for young children in various settings, providing activities, managing routines, and helping develop social skills.
Nanny
A Nanny cares for young children at home, assisting with routines, activities, and basic chores while ensuring safety and communication.
Early Childhood Educator
An Early Childhood Educator delivers educational programs in childcare settings, assisting in teaching and supporting diverse groups of young children.
Kindergarten Teacher
A Kindergarten Teacher creates learning programs for young children, focusing on literacy, numeracy, social skills, and communication while building strong relationships with families.
Early Childhood Teacher
An Early Childhood Teacher educates young children before primary school, focusing on literacy, numeracy, and social skills through engaging activities.
Childcare Centre Manager
A Childcare Centre Manager oversees daily operations, manages rostering and budgets, ensures compliance, and communicates with staff and parents.
Outside School Hours Care Coordinator
An Outside School Hours Care Coordinator manages before/after school programs, plans activities, and ensures safety, communication, and child support.
